Background technology
Recent two decades comes, and the fast development of the industry such as China's energy, industry, traffic brings very important environmental pollution.Wherein, the pollution problem of Atmospheric particulates is especially prominent.The particulate matter of different-grain diameter along with human body respiration at different respiratory tract site deposition.Wherein particle diameter is blocked in outside nasal cavity at the particulate matter of 10-100 μm, and 2.5-10 μm of particulate matter major part retains in nasopharynx district, and 0.01-2.5 μm of particulate matter is deposited on bronchus and pulmonary, and about 0.1 μm particulate matter major sedimentary is in pulmonary, and harm is maximum.Wherein the particle diameter particulate matter less than 2.5 μm is referred to as PM2.5.At present, it is one of topmost air pollution source of China that PM2.5 pollutes, and the monitoring of PM2.5 and effective improvement are the targets of China environmental protection department and national government, and the healthy living of people is had important practical significance.
The sensor of original indoor PM2.5 monitoring equipment and air supply device and power supply unit adopt Split type structure.Sensor is outside casing, it is necessary to be connected to the casing of air particle monitoring equipment by output line and pure air pipeline, causes the installation inconvenience of equipment.The structure comparison of original casing is compact, it would be desirable to installing DTU teletransmission equipment and increase display screen, original casing is difficult to meet this type of requirement, it is necessary to the redesign to the structure of casing.

Detailed description of the invention
Below in conjunction with Figure of description, the utility model will be further described.
A kind of indoor PM2.5 monitors the casing of device, including the shell constituting cabinet space, its housing includes bottom panel 1, front plate, side panel and upper, lower panel 7, bottom panel 1 is wherein provided with base and is perpendicular to the baffle plate 3 of bottom panel, wherein base 2 installs air supply device and electronic circuit board, wherein cabinet space is divided into two parts by baffle plate 3, a part is for being arranged on air supply unit on base and power supply unit, a part is sensing unit, wherein it is provided with locating slot 6 and the positioning plate 4 of vertical bottom face plate in sensing unit, wherein the height of baffle plate 3 is less than the distance between bottom panel and front plate, wherein the plate face of baffle plate is provided with the baffle holes 31 that can install DTU teletransmission equipment.
Further, locating slot 6 is two and has therebetween certain distance, and wherein the height of locating slot 6 cell body is less than the height of baffle plate 3.
Further, positioning plate 4 be provided above being perpendicular to the location upper plate 5 of lower panel, wherein the distance between location upper plate 5 and positioning plate 4 is more than the height of locating slot 6 less than the height of baffle plate, wherein is used for fixing sensor between positioning plate 4 and location upper plate.
Further, casing front plate is provided with cabinet door 8, cabinet door is wherein provided with casing aperture of door 9 and display lamp 10.
Further, base 2 is fixed with bottom panel by the bolt of lower base being arranged on base corner.
Further, bottom panel is provided with for fixing hanging hole 11.
Operation principle: will be installed on base 2 except the components and parts of sensor and DTU teletransmission equipment, and be fixed on casing.DTU teletransmission equipment is fixed on baffle plate 3, then sensor is arranged in casing by location-plate and locating slot 6, is fixed on floor by fixture and bolt of lower base.Display screen is installed in the hole of top cover of box.Connect circuit and power supply.
This utility model achieves the integration of sensor and air supply device and power supply component, and can be installed in casing by data remote DTU equipment, it is also possible to be installed on cabinet door by display screen.
